Brno is the second largest city in the Czech Republic (Prague is the largest) and home to nearly 400,000 people. Known for its history, museums, and architecture, Brno has some pretty impressive sights. The second-largest and second-oldest museum in the Czech Republic, Moravské zemské, resides in Brno.
